Given Data:

Distance = 200 km

Initial Velocity = Vi = 0 m/s

Time = 2 hours

Required:

Acceleration = a = ?

Formula:

2nd equation of motion

Solution:

[tex]\displaystyle S = Vit+\frac{1}{2} at^2\\\\200 = (0)(2)+\frac{1}{2} a(2)^2\\\\200 = \frac{1}{2} a (4)\\\\200 = 2a\\\\Divide\ both\ sides\ by\ 2\\\\200/2 = a\\\\a = 100\ kmh^{-2}\\\\\rule[225]{225}{2}[/tex]
